查询课程教师的姓名跟工号的语句
时间: 2024-02-23 09:57:59 浏览: 43
您可以使用如下 SQL 语句查询课程教师的姓名和工号:
```
SELECT teacher_name, teacher_id
FROM course
```
其中,`teacher_name` 和 `teacher_id` 分别为课程表中存储教师姓名和工号的字段。您可以根据实际情况进行修改。
相关问题
查询c01上课程的教师的姓名跟教工号
您可以使用如下 SQL 语句查询编号为 c01 的课程的教师姓名和工号:
```
SELECT teacher_name, teacher_id
FROM course
WHERE course_id = 'c01'
```
其中,`teacher_name` 和 `teacher_id` 分别为课程表中存储教师姓名和工号的字段,`course_id` 为课程编号,您可以根据实际情况进行修改。
假设有以下四个表: 学生表 Student:包含学生的学号和姓名。 课程表 Course:包含课程的编号和教师工号。 教师表 Teacher:包含教师的工号和姓名。 成绩表 score:包含学号、课程号 四个表联合查询 查询没学过"王二"老师讲授的任一门课程的学生姓名
可以使用如下 SQL 语句进行联合查询:
```
SELECT DISTINCT Student.姓名
FROM Student, Course, Teacher, score
WHERE Student.学号 = score.学号
AND Course.课程号 = score.课程号
AND Course.教师工号 = Teacher.工号
AND Teacher.姓名 = '王二'
AND Student.姓名 NOT IN (
SELECT DISTINCT Student.姓名
FROM Student, Course, Teacher, score
WHERE Student.学号 = score.学号
AND Course.课程号 = score.课程号
AND Course.教师工号 = Teacher.工号
AND Teacher.姓名 = '王二'
)
```
其中,首先通过 `WHERE` 子句将四个表进行联合查询,并且限制教师姓名为 '王二'。然后,在子查询中查询出所有选过 '王二' 老师讲授的课程的学生姓名,最后在主查询中使用 `NOT IN` 子句将已选过该老师课程的学生排除掉,即可得到查询结果。
相关推荐
![doc](https://img-home.csdnimg.cn/images/20210720083327.png)
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![docx](https://img-home.csdnimg.cn/images/20210720083331.png)
![-](https://csdnimg.cn/download_wenku/file_type_column_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)